Today we are excited to announce our partnership with eProvenance, a leader in solutions to monitor and analyze shipment conditions of sensitive and perishable cargo. With this partnership, we are offering Smart Cargo + Cyber™ policyholders an option for additional monitoring services that will help them to improve the quality and consistency of shipments of wine and other sensitive goods, as well as enhanced coverage. 

eProvenance solutions use innovative, patented technology to deliver insights on transport and storage practices to help clients make better business decisions and assure the quality of their goods. Central to the solution is the eProvenance Score, which clearly validates if you are taking great care of your wine shipments and your channel is delivering on your quality promise or indicates the extent of shipment damage (if any).

Delivering Value Beyond Coverage

Corvus's Smart Cargo + CyberTM policies are used by wineries and other beverage companies across the U.S., providing them with the industry's broadest coverage including a first-of-its-kind affirmative cyber coverage endorsement. With this partnership we offer enhanced coverage based on the eProvenance Score, and policyholders get an integrated partner for monitoring services, including the use of proprietary sensors for tracking the temperature of shipments, a Customer Care Team to handle sensor shipment and collection, and an online dashboard for viewing reports and analysis. 

As with all Corvus policies, brokers and policyholders working with Smart Cargo + Cyber get a detailed Dynamic Loss Prevention (DLP) Report, which includes AI-driven data Corvus gathers on cargo risk and cyber risk. DLP Reports are provided at the start of the policy and at regular intervals during the policy term. Between the Corvus DLP, the eProvenance Score, and ongoing monitoring from both companies covering cyber risk and per-shipment temperature data, wineries and beverage distributors are equipped with an unprecedented view of their overall risk.
